What factors mainly affect the air delivery pressure of a fan?

2016-05-03View Original

Thread Content

Is wind pressure directly proportional only to air volume?
Reply #22016-05-03
Wind pressure is inversely proportional to air volume. The air delivery pressure of the fan is primarily influenced by back pressure, the output power of the drive mechanism, the opening degree of the intake valve, and the opening degree of the exhaust valve.
